Output d66dc864946440f35e3738dedc54429d6ac08e23a3fa8d24821df96e2c42c448:0

value
815105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46e5caa23fabee26b502cdded4a8b833271d36d3 OP_EQUAL
address
389tWAgx73ob44DohaGuM6Z6bmf4VRM8Xj
transaction
d66dc864946440f35e3738dedc54429d6ac08e23a3fa8d24821df96e2c42c448
confirmations
340116
spent
true